masterful |
| |
| ADJECTIVE: | 1. Exercising authority: authoritative, commanding, dominant, lordly. See OVER, STRONG. 2. Tending to dictate: authoritarian, bossy, dictatorial, dogmatic, domineering, imperious, magisterial, overbearing, peremptory. See OVER. 3. Having or demonstrating a high degree of knowledge or skill: adept, crack, expert, master, masterly, professional, proficient, skilled, skillful. Slang : crackerjack. See ABILITY.
